New Gig Series Generation WHY to Launch in Mumbai This Week

The independent music property seeks to introduce audiences to artists from multiple genres

Jan 02, 2017

While the number of independent artists in India is always on the rise, they’re often eclipsed by the mainstream, crowd-pulling worlds of EDM, Bollywood and pop. Perhaps  the eclipse simply comes from the public’s reluctance to explore the world of the unknown indie artists and their capabilities. Aftab Khan, former Programmer/Events Executive at Hard Rock Café India, is hoping change this pattern. His upcoming independent music property Generation WHY is about helping people discover music they normally wouldn’t explore. “Being a fan of a lot of different genres, the idea was to have a showcase for people with an open mind,” explains Khan who has curated the entire show.

Scheduled for January 5th at the Hard Rock Café Andheri in Mumbai, the entire concept is built around encouraging people to find new music through the genres they already love. The lineup for Generation WHY’s debut edition will feature Mumbai-based multilingual hip hop crew Swadesi, Pune-based post-rockers Cat Kamikazee, pop-rock band The Ryan Victor Project and Mumbai-based psychedelic act MILK - all musicians who are vastly different from one another. “If someone comes to see hip hop from Swadesi, they might watch Cat Kamikazee and end up liking them,” says Khan. “At least that’s what we’re hoping for.”

Khan has chosen artists based on the genre they represent and how good they sound live. He also adds that all of them are bands he genuinely loves. “I saw Swadesi at the Hip Hop Homeland gig at Antisocial and I’ve known Ryan [Victor] for a while — I saw him perform at Hard Rock, I’ve programmed him before and he’s actually my senior from school,” says Khan. He goes on to say that he discovered MILK when they applied to Hard Rock Café India for a competition, while Cat Kamikazee is a relatively recent discovery.

For the next edition set to happen in March, Khan says he wants to explore a whole new set of genres to keep the variety of the series going. “The plan is to have one progressive rock band, a jazzy soul band and I’m also keen on exploring live electronic acts which I can’t really do at Hard Rock, which is why I need to move to a different venue,” he says. He adds that punk and metal are future paths he wants to walk down and give as many people as possible the chance to discover something they didn’t expect to. “There is something or the other you’re going to find which you will really love,” he promises.

 

Generation WHY ft Swadesi, MILK, Cat Kamikazee and The Ryan Victor Project takes place on January 5th, 2017 at Hard Rock Café, Andheri in Mumbai. Event details here.
